The Nanophotonics section of the Debye Institute for Nanomaterials Science is looking for a technician and laser safety coordinator (f/m/+) to support our scientific research in the field of interaction between light and matter.

No day is the same as a Research Technician in our group. In this role, you help researchers, PhD candidates, and students in performing cutting-edge experiments to achieve reproducible results. You will participate in the design and construction of laser set-ups and you take care of the installation and maintenance.

As laser safety coordinator, you will be supervising the procedures, installations, and design of the experiment rooms. You have received laser safety education (possibly as part of your BSc study program) and/or are willing to take courses on the subject. You like to bring or keep your knowledge up-to-date through courses and self-study.

As manager of the laser laboratory, you are the one to order equipment, optics, and components and manage the consumables. You will become part of the research group and work intensively with fellow technicians, also from other research groups, and from the general support and technical departments of Utrecht University.

The Nanophotonics group is part of the Debye Institute for Nanomaterials Science and the Department of Physics of the Faculty of Science at Utrecht University. Our research focuses on the shaping and control of light and matter waves and their applications in technology for a sustainable society. Our existing research lines focus on the fundamental physics of Bose-Einstein condensates, optical metrology for industrial and medical applications, and light-material interaction at very high intensities. We work closely with groups that conduct research into, among other things, the theory of quantum materials, the experimental realisation of electron waves in quantum materials constructed on an atomic scale, electrochemistry, catalysis and energy storage materials, and self-assembly of quantum materials.
